CSS設(shè)置水平無(wú)滾動(dòng)條
隨著現(xiàn)代網(wǎng)頁(yè)的設(shè)計(jì)趨勢(shì),越來(lái)越多的網(wǎng)站需要使用CSS來(lái)調(diào)整頁(yè)面布局和樣式。其中,設(shè)置水平無(wú)滾動(dòng)條是一種常見(jiàn)的CSS技巧,可以讓頁(yè)面中的元素水平排列,而不會(huì)導(dǎo)致滾動(dòng)條的出現(xiàn)。
在CSS中,我們可以使用`position: relative`來(lái)設(shè)置元素的相對(duì)位置,`position: absolute`來(lái)設(shè)置元素的定位方式,而`top`和`bottom`屬性則用于設(shè)置元素相對(duì)于父元素的垂直位置。通過(guò)將這些屬性設(shè)置為`0`,我們可以使元素垂直位置固定,而不會(huì)導(dǎo)致頁(yè)面中的元素向下滾動(dòng)。
下面是一個(gè)示例代碼,展示了如何使用CSS來(lái)設(shè)置水平無(wú)滾動(dòng)條:
```html
<div class="container">
<h1>Hello World!</h1>
<p>This is a paragraph.</p>
</div>
```css
.container {
position: relative;
width: 400px;
height: 200px;
.container h1 {
position: absolute;
top: 0;
bottom: 0;
left: 0;
right: 0;
.container p {
position: absolute;
top: 40%;
bottom: 0;
left: 0;
right: 0;
在上面的代碼中,我們使用了`position: relative`來(lái)設(shè)置元素的位置,然后使用`position: absolute`來(lái)設(shè)置元素的定位方式。我們首先將`h1`元素和`p`元素的定位屬性設(shè)置為`0`,使它們垂直位置固定。然后,我們使用`top`和`bottom`屬性分別設(shè)置`h1`元素和`p`元素相對(duì)于父元素的垂直位置。最后,我們使用`left`和`right`屬性分別設(shè)置`h1`元素和`p`元素相對(duì)于父元素的水平位置。
通過(guò)將`top`和`bottom`屬性設(shè)置為`0`以及`left`和`right`屬性設(shè)置為`0`,我們可以使元素垂直位置固定,而不會(huì)導(dǎo)致頁(yè)面中的元素向下滾動(dòng)。最后,我們使用CSS來(lái)調(diào)整元素的大小和位置,使其在水平方向上排列得正確。
需要注意的是,如果元素的`top`和`bottom`屬性設(shè)置得不正確,可能會(huì)導(dǎo)致頁(yè)面中的元素向上或向下滾動(dòng)。因此,在使用CSS來(lái)設(shè)置水平無(wú)滾動(dòng)條時(shí),需要仔細(xì)測(cè)試和調(diào)整元素的CSS屬性,以確保其正確性。